  4. Hi im not Linux user not all, can someone point me how to enable SPI ? I try this: Enabling SPI Enable the hardware through config: sudo armbian-config switch on SPI in System>Hardware>SPI-spidev & save Update /etc/modules: sudo nano /etc/modules to include the following line: spi-dev Update /boot/armbianEnv.txt : sudo nano /boot/armbianEnv.txt to include the following: param_spidev_spi_bus=1 #origianl is 0 but the resonance measurement.py module expects 1 so easier to fix here param_spidev_max_freq=100000000 The commands to verify the SPI bus should return output like: $ ls /dev/spi* /dev/spidev1.0 $ ls -l /dev/spi* crw——- 1 root root 153, 0 Aug 25 11:05 /dev/spidev1.0 $ lsmod | grep -i spi spidev 20480 1 But on $ ls /dev/spi* give me ls: cannot access '/dev/spi*': No such file or directory dmesg https://pastebin.com/BNSpyMiL Keep in mind English is not my native language.

  19. Hello! I met next problem: I need configure UART communication with baud rate 1 Mb/s (or 2 or 3). But internal clock of the bus is 1.5 MHz, and if i try to communicate with 1 Mb/s, error is too big. Is it possible somehow change internal clock of the uart? Or maybe any other possibilities how to configure such communication ? Or maybe you know any models with higher internal clock of the bus (Like on 6.5 MHz on raspberry pi 4, for example) ? Now one section is equal to 1.333 microseconds, but it should be 1.0 mcs. I found same topic at this forum, but it's no solution there: Thank you and have a good day
